Pins 1 to 4 are for battery measurement (only applicable to APC XR
Enclosures).
Pins 5 and 6 are for external maintenance bypass Q3 (auxiliary switch
N/C type). When Q3 is closed, signals are fed back to the UPS controller.
Pins 7 and 8 are for external charge control. When 7 and 8 are closed, the
UPS charges batteries with a pre-defined percentage (0-25-50-75-100%)
of the maximum charging power. To be used in generator applications, or
if special codes requires control of charging.
When Q3 is closed, signals are fed back to the UPS controller.
Connection of APC communication options
(PowerChute software and temperature sensor)
Feed cables from optional communication equipment through the
opening in the top cover.
Guide the cables along the inside of the left side panel down to the
opening in the power module frame.
Attach communication equipment where shown.
Note
When connecting the Q3 auxiliary signal, use gold-plated N/C
auxiliary switch on Q3.
Note
The APC communication options are provided at the front of
the UPS.

Recommended current protection
To ensure the correct functionality of the PDU and to avoid
unintentional tripping of the bypass input protection device follow
the following recommendation:
Use the SUVTOPT114 (20kVA version) or the SUVT115 (30kVA
version) as input protection.
Output protection is included in the PDU of the unit.
Note: Be aware that for single mains this is also the mains input
protective device.
Note: Using a solution solely based on breakers, selectivity for load short
circuit currents higher than 2kA cannot be assured for the 3-phased
output. If this is required, use fuses to protect the bypass.

If fuses are preferred, the following can be used:
Ensure that the short-circuit current on the UPS input is less than 20AiC
sym RMS. Also take into consideration the below breaker settings to
ensure correct functionality during overload operation.
UPS size Breaker/fuse
20 kVA version 480 V input voltage 40 A
30 kVA version 480 V input voltage 50 A
Note
Breakers/fuses other than APC SUVTOPT need complete
selectivity assessments.
